Patent number: 11612952Abstract: A method of fixing a membrane to a surface is disclosed. The method includes affixing a metallic washer having a heat-activated adhesive layer on a surface; arranging a membrane on top of the surface and the heat-activated adhesive layer of the metallic washer; heating the metallic washer to activate the heat-activated adhesive layer such that the membrane is fixable to the metallic washer; positioning a magnetic clamping heat sink assembly on the membrane; magnetically clamping the magnetic clamping heat sink assembly to the metallic washer causing the magnetic clamping heat sink assembly to apply a force against the membrane when the magnetic clamping heat sink assembly sufficiently overlaps the metallic washer to form a secure bond; and cooling the metallic washer, the heat-activated adhesive layer, and the membrane by removing heat through the magnetic clamping heat sink assembly.Type: GrantFiled: January 7, 2021Date of Patent: March 28, 2023Assignee: SFS Intec Holding AGInventors: Daniel Scheerer, Jarrod Woodland, Rob Stricek

Patent number: 10919104Abstract: A magnetic clamping heat sink assembly is disclosed including a magnetic assembly with a carrier body including a magnet. A spring resiliently biases the carrier body. A base assembly includes a base plate. In a first operating condition, the base assembly of the magnetic clamping heat sink assembly is positioned in a first position away from a ferromagnetic element, and the spring holds the carrier body at a medial position spaced apart from the base plate. In a second operating condition, the base assembly of the magnetic clamping heat sink assembly is positioned in a second position adjacent to the ferromagnetic element, and the carrier body is driven downward against a force of the spring to a lower position and into contact with the base plate by magnetic attraction between the at least one magnet and the ferromagnetic element.Type: GrantFiled: February 28, 2018Date of Patent: February 16, 2021Assignee: SFS INTEC HOLDING AGInventors: Daniel Scheerer, Jarrod Woodland, Rob Stricek

Patent number: 10662994Abstract: A self-drilling, self-countersinking fastener is provided that includes a shaft, a countersunk head located at a first end of the shaft, and a tapered point located at an opposite end of the shaft. A thread integrally extends from the shaft and extends along at least a portion of a length thereof. The countersunk head includes a frustoconical region having a first, smaller diameter in a shaft connection region and a second, larger diameter at a second end defining an edge area of the head. A plurality of radially extending ribs are located on the frustoconical region and extend from an area of the first, smaller diameter to a respective radially outer rib end spaced radially inwardly by a distance X from the edge area of the head. A respective cutting edge is located on each of the ribs.Type: GrantFiled: September 20, 2017Date of Patent: May 26, 2020Assignee: SFS intec Holding AGInventors: Daniel Scheerer, James Cole

Patent number: 9611882Abstract: A fastener is provided having a cylindrical shaft with a generally constant diameter located between a head and a tapered point. The fastener has a thread integrally extending from the shaft and extending along a portion of a length thereof that terminates at an end of the shaft proximate the head with a back-out discontinuity. At least one ring integrally extends from the shaft in an area of the shaft between the back-out discontinuity and the head. The at least one ring has an outside diameter that is less than an outside diameter of the thread.Type: GrantFiled: September 9, 2014Date of Patent: April 4, 2017Assignee: SFS intec Holding AGInventor: Daniel Scheerer

Patent number: 9506490Abstract: A fastener includes a cylindrical shaft located between a head and a tapered point, threads integrally extending from the shaft and extending along a portion of a length thereof, and a burr cutoff area near the tapered point and including flank surfaces therein forming an angle greater than 90° therebetween. A flattened area can be located between the flank surfaces.Type: GrantFiled: September 29, 2014Date of Patent: November 29, 2016Assignee: SFS intec Holding AGInventor: Daniel Scheerer
